Attribute definitions and instructions
margin shorthand property sets all margin properties in one declaration. This property can have the value 1-4.
Example:
- margin: 10px 5px 15px 20px;
- The margins are 10px
- Right margin is 5px
- Lower margins are 15px
- Left margin is 20px
- margin: 10px 5px 15px;
- The margins are 10px
- On the right and left margins are 5px
- Lower margins are 15px
- margin: 10px 5px;
- On the top and bottom margins are 10px
- On the right and left margins are 5px
- margin: 10px;
- All four margins are 10px
Note: negative values are allowed.

Property Value
value | description |
---|---|
auto | Browser calculated margin. |
length | In particular the provisions margin Unit of value, such as pixels, centimeters, and the like. The default value is 0px. |
% | Based on a predetermined percentage of the parent element width margins. |
inherit | The provisions margin should inherit from the parent element. |
